Tasks

-Attend Eichleay project team meetings. -Manage schedules. -Under the direction of a Senior Electrical Engineer perform scope development and create technical specifications for electrical equipment and modifications. -Under the direction of a Senior Electrical Engineer performing load calculations, voltage drop, conduit/cable sizing, lighting and grounding design -Candidates will be required to follow our clients' site based rules and protocols regarding infectious diseases. -Application of codes and standards -Coordinate with vendors. -While performing duties of this job, you would occasionally be required to stand, walk, sit, reach with hands and arms, climb or balance, stoop or kneel, talk and hear (this includes being able to hear and talk on site based communication equipment), distinguish between various colors, be able to hear safety tones/notifications, and use fingers and hands to feel objects, tools, temperature or controls. -Travel: Occasionally travel to Eichleay offices and client sites across the Western US (up to 25%) -Consistently achieve goals, delivering quality and accurate work and meet project schedules. -Prepare material requisitions for bid and technical bid evaluation, including reviewing of specifications of equipment, and responding to vendor submittals.

What You Bring

-Proficiency in developing one-line diagrams, wiring schematics, and performing load calculations, voltage drop, conduit/cable sizing, lighting and grounding design -Software skills -Demonstrate awareness and commitment to health, safety and environmental issues. Address issues as necessary to ensure zero harm to all employees clients, and contractors with zero environmental incidents. -TWIC Certification and current card or ability to obtain. -RSO Safety Training and current card or ability to obtain. -Experience in the development of electrical specifications and calculations. -Bachelors or better in Engineering -Research skills -Familiarity with NEC, NFPA, API, and IEEE standards for hazardous locations. -Quick learner -Ability to assemble electrical engineering, drawing and construction work packages for review and approval, that may include one-line diagrams, wiring schematics and other required electrical deliverables. -Must occasionally lift and/or move up to 25 pounds. -Presentation skills -Specific vision abilities required include close vision, distance vision, depth perceptions, and the ability to adjust focus. -Background screening including previous employment, education, criminal history, and driving record verification. -Attention to detail -Working towards the passing of Fundamentals of Engineering exam is expected. -Collaboration: Ability to form and foster collaborative relationships within Eichleay and with clients and partners. -Critical thinking -Under the direction of a Senior Electrical Engineer, become familiar with site, global and industry electrical standards and electrical safety, including NEC, IEEE, API, and NFPA 70E and 497. -Experience working onsite at a refinery or similar industrial facility. -Client Safety Training and current badge or ability to obtain. -Possess strong verbal and written communication skills. -Proficient in Microsoft Office applications and working experience with AutoCAD/NavisWorks. RevitMEP experience is desired. -Participation in random drug and alcohol program. -Ability to coordinate with other disciplines and project management in a team environment. -Experience: 1 to 5 years experience in Refinery or other oil and gas related industries. -Time management -Education: Bachelor of Science degree in electrical engineering. -Computer skills -Experience with low and medium voltage systems is desirable.

The Company

About Eichleay, Inc.

-Family‑owned for five generations, combining small‑company agility with big‑company capabilities. -Specializes in industrial sectors including energy & chemical, life sciences, mining & metals, and sustainable energy facilities. -Delivers end‑to‑end services from engineering and design to commissioning, ensuring comprehensive project management. -Notable successes include flue gas scrubbers, biodiesel and biowaste‑to‑energy plants, life‑science expansions, and mining‑related facilities. -Combines deep technical resources (fire-protection, SIS safety, MOTEMS) with nimble execution for mid-to-large-scale industrial projects.
